The appeal hearing at the Special Court against Corruption and Organized Crime of Saimir Tahiri and Jaeld Çela the former director of Vlora Police was postponed to January 5.

Meanwhile, Çela has requested the dismissal of the presiding judge Daniela Shirka, but his request has been rejected.

At the end of the session, the former Minister of Interior refused to comment to the media. Tahiri was charged with drug trafficking, but the court only sentenced him for abuse of office, converted into 3.4 years of probation.

The file of Tahiri and Çela was sent to the Appellate Court by the Supreme Court following the latter’s decision.
